Output 69ebb932c6fdb1dde09d7e83eb0c0c3e2c52cda2a6c80098b380a6601b6429f3:0

value
35206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e537e51f817a8579114a343b96d5b08dfdc93d8 OP_EQUAL
address
3EfZu1W6SweLvQyE9HLdwnFP3U51otfT8f
transaction
69ebb932c6fdb1dde09d7e83eb0c0c3e2c52cda2a6c80098b380a6601b6429f3
confirmations
343161
spent
true